Tony Mackay who is a senior consultant for the OECD Schooling for Tomorrow Project, is in town today and tomorrow.

He is going to talk to educators, business and community leaders at the Secondary Futures symposium about the future of education in New Zealand.

Have a look at today’s Dominion Post - there’s a long piece by Tony -
“So much of education is still determined by short-term thinking - a preoccupation with immedaite problems or simply seeking more efficient ways of maintaining established practice.”

He was a key mover in the recent 2020 summit in Australia which took the concept of a ‘community conversation’ about the long term future, to a whole new level. According to Tony there were 10,000 applicants for 1000 places at the conference. “It was democracy at work, an attempt to engage the community - and they did it without cynicism.”
